Programs to Support Legal Socialization Reform in Armenia: INL is currently seeking an organization with the requisite capability and experience to support Armenian communities in preventing juvenile delinquency through social justice activities for Armenian youth in coordination with the Armenian law enforcement, and bringing about a fundamental shift of thinking within the police, courts, correction facilities, and community towards restorative justice elements. INL is currently seeking a recipient to provide prioritized attention to as many of the following key objectives as possible. Note that special consideration will be given to creative non-traditional program methods, which demonstrate results-oriented activities and strong program evaluation mechanisms.
